ANNA UNIVERSITY: CHENNAI – 600 025

B.E./B.TECH DEGREE EXAMINATIONS

Regulations – R2008

Sixth semester

EI2356 Process control system laboratory


Time: 3 Hours Maximum marks: 100

1. Implement a step response of interacting and non-interacting system and to


determine the transfer function of individual and overall system. (100)

2. Develop a suitable controller [which has two measurements and one


manipulation] for a process with following transfer function and obtain its
response through simulation.
Gprimary = e-2S/ (30S+1)(3 S+1) (100)
2
Gsecondary =1 / (S+1) (10 S+1)

3. Design a suitable controller [which takes control action before the load impact is
felt] for a process with following transfer function and obtain its response through
simulation.
Gp = 20 e- 0.7 S/(4S+1) (100)
- 0.2 S
Gd = 5 e /(4S+1)

4. Determine the transient response of a first order process with and without
transportation delay and second order process with and without transportation
delay to step change in input. (100)

5. a) Simulate the response of I order system with τ - 25 and K= 2 with


transportation delay of 20 sec and show that speed of response decreases with
increase in τ. (50)

b) Reduce the given transfer function into I order transfer function with delay
using MATLAB
Gp(s) = [1/(2s+1)] * [1/(3s+1)] * [1/(5s+1)] (50)

6. Obtain the open loop response of a I order Electronic system with and without
transportation lag (Choose open loop gain = 3) and determine the time constant by
conducting suitable experiment. (100)

7. Conduct an experiment to record the transient response to a step change of first


order process and second order process for level process with and without
transportation lag and calculate the process gain, time constant and dead time of
the process from the step response. (100)

8. Design a PID controller (use open loop response method) for the given system
and obtain the response for r(t) = 5u(t) using MATLAB simulation
Gp(S) = 1 / (6S3+11S2+6S+1). (100)

9. Design a PID controller (use ultimate cycling method) for the given system and
obtain the response for r(t) = 3u(t) using MATLAB simulation
Gp(S) = 1 / (6S3+11S2+6S+1). (100)

10. Conduct an experiment to plot the response of P, P+I, P+I+D controllers for step
and ramp inputs. Also determine the calibration of the proportional, Integral and
derivative adjustments. (100)

11. Plot the flow-lift characteristics of the given control valve without positioner for
keeping constant and variable pressure levels. Also compute the valve gain at
different operating points. (100)

12. Plot the flow-lift characteristics of the given control valve with valve positioner
for keeping constant and variable pressure levels. Also compute the valve gain at
different operating points. (100)

13. Conduct an experiment to compare the responses of closed loop flow control
system using PI mode for servo and regulator operation. Also comment on
response of the control loop for changes in the set point and load variable. (100)

14. Conduct an experiment to compare the responses of closed loop flow control
system using P, PI and PID modes. Also comment on response of the control loop
for changes in the set point and load variable. (100)

15. Design and construct a PID controller and tune the controller with the help of
Cohen and coon method using simulation. (100)

16. Design and construct a PID controller and tune the controller with the help of
Ziegler Nichol’s method using simulation. (100)

17. Determine the closed loop performance of a cascade control system and compare
it with that of conventional system. (100)

18. Obtain the transfer function of the II order liquid level system of Fig.1. (100)

19. Obtain the closed loop response of thermal system using a two position controller.
(100)

20. Experimentally Obtain the closed loop response of a II order Electronic system
for a three mode controller with PB = 20% (100)
